Primitive Love: Exploring the Raw Emotions in 'Neanderthal Man' by 10cc

The song 'Neanderthal Man' by 10cc is a fascinating exploration of primal instincts and raw emotions. The repetitive lyrics, 'I'm a Neanderthal man, You're a Neanderthal woman, Let's make Neanderthal love, In this Neanderthal world,' emphasize a return to basic, unrefined human nature. By invoking the image of Neanderthals, the song strips away the complexities of modern life, focusing instead on the fundamental aspects of human connection and love.

The use of the term 'Neanderthal' is metaphorical, suggesting a desire to reconnect with a more instinctual and unpretentious form of existence. In a world often dominated by technology and societal expectations, the song's simplicity serves as a reminder of the inherent, uncomplicated nature of human relationships. The repetition of the lyrics reinforces this idea, creating a hypnotic effect that draws the listener into a more primitive state of mind.

10cc, known for their eclectic and often satirical approach to music, uses 'Neanderthal Man' to challenge the listener to consider what is truly essential in life. The song's minimalist structure and raw, almost chant-like delivery highlight the band's ability to convey deep meaning through simplicity. By focusing on the basic human need for connection and love, 10cc invites us to reflect on our own lives and the ways in which we might strip away the unnecessary to find what truly matters.
